Ensure subcontractors are advised of all change orders
Prepare and submit change orders for approval by clients and director of operations.
Oversee electrical trades and coordination
Manage all staff assigned to project and relationship management among project owner, owner’s tenants and all professional groups involved.
Complete or review project reports for accuracy, provide status and financial reports and project schedules.
Performs final review of constructions projects including bid reviews, bid procedures, vendor & subcontractor qualifications, final estimates, labor & materials takeoffs.
Oversight of electrical throughout the construction management process.
Prepare all close out documentation including warranty information, affidavits, record drawings,
Approve for payment or negotiate changes.
Monitor schedules, spending and related.
Ensure final payments are received form client and appropriate invoices paid to subcontractors
Oversee timely and accurate completion of all documentation and administrative aspects relating to project management execution.
Review subcontractor and vendor invoices

8-12 years in commercial construction management
Coming from the sub-contractor world is okay / acceptable
Heavy Electrical background required
Bachelor’s degree in Construction Management or Construction Science is preferred
Experience with BIM / Navisworks / BIM Glue / Revit or equivalent expected

Now part of the STO Building Group family, leveraging collective expertise across North America and Europe to deliver large-scale projects.
The firm manages end-to-end construction—from site analysis and design-constructability reviews to new buildings and fit-outs.
Typical projects span commercial offices, hospitals, schools, labs, retail outlets, hotels, data centers, and government facilities.
Its technical depth includes complex mission-critical environments and life-science labs that demand precision and coordination.
With a history of high-profile urban builds, the company is known for seamlessly integrating cutting-edge design and execution.
As a privately held, multi-brand organization, it taps into shared resources and bonding capacity to handle massive, multi-market endeavors.
